What does payments to acquire federal home loan bank stock mean?
Captures cash outflows required to purchase FHLB stock, which is often a mandatory requirement for maintaining membership and accessing FHLB credit facilities. It reflects the company's reliance on FHLB funding and its capital commitment to this liquidity source.
